Lever/Lever
The lever handles for doors are used to operate a multi-point lock that uses an Euro cylinder. They are found on a variety of double upvc door handle repair doors as well as some wooden and aluminium doors. They come in two forms, having a lever on the interior and a paddle on the outside. Sprung - They have a spring cassette inside the backplate, which helps bring the handle lever to a horizontal position. Non-sprung - These do not include a spring mechanism and will need to be manually pulled to raise the handle lever back to its horizontal position.
To fix a door handle lever that is sagging you'll need to locate the hole or detent access pin. It's usually a small hole or protruding ring or rectangle that is located on the base of the handle plate. Once you have located the hole for accessing the detent or pin, you are able to remove it with an screwdriver.
After the handle is placed horizontally, you can install the screws. Tighten them to ensure that the handle stays attached to the base plate. It is also advisable to apply a threadlocking adhesive solution to the threads of the screw to increase the grip and prevent them from becoming loose over time.
There are a myriad of reasons why lever door handles drop. The most common cause is that the fixings are too tight which causes the lever bearing to get tangled up against the door. It could also be that the levers haven't been operated at a right angle, which causes compression of the latch mechanism, preventing it from fully springing into action.
Another common reason is that the lever that is sprung is not functioning properly and this is usually due to the sprung not being in the right position within the backplate. To check whether the handle is back to horizontal, Upvc door handle repairs near me simply operate it.
It is essential to fix any loose door handles immediately. This could cause excessive wear on the screws and the handle might be able to fall off the base plate. It is recommended to tighten all screws that are loose regularly in order to prevent them from loosening.
Lever/Snib
These upvc door handle repair handles are called "Snib handle sets" and come with a snib lock button at the top of the lever. If you don't have a dummy locking device, you can use this feature to secure the door. These door handles are fitted with the Fullex lock 68PZ. (68mm between the spindle and the lock centre). You can make your home more modern by changing your door handles whether you are replacing existing handles or installing new ones on doors that you constructed. There are many styles to choose from for door handles made of upvc including the classic lever on backplate. Other options include straight or curly short latches, as well as Dummy knobs for multi-point locks. These are ideal for French doors.
Lever on backplate handles are often rectangular in shape, however there are also oval or circular versions, which are known as rose door handles. These handles are identified by a lever or knob that is mounted on the backplate. The backplate is removable for Upvc Door Handle Repairs Near Me concealed fixing.
There are a wide range of chrome and colored finishes for these handles to match your door and other hardware, such as bolts, knobs and hinges. Some handles come with grub screws, which aid in the secure attachment of the lever or knob to the spindle. Other handles come with bathroom spindles that can be used to operate bathroom locks and feature a thumbturn turn as well as a release mechanism, perfect for use on bathroom doors.
